BlockBeats news, on March 14, U.S. stocks opened higher but closed lower, with the Dow Jones Industrial Average initially down 0.25%, the S&P 500 down 0.6%, and the Nasdaq Composite down 0.93%. Several prominent tech stocks weakened, with Adobe (ADBE.O) falling 7.5% and Meta Platforms (META.O) dropping 3.8%. The Nasdaq China Golden Dragon Index closed up 0.75%.


Cryptocurrency-related stocks saw gains reversed: MSTR rose 1.70%, COIN rose 1.19%, CRCL rose 1.05%, SBET rose 0.67%, and BMNR fell 0.05%.
